    If grandma has no court order of guardianship or custody, then "status quo" counts for nothing unless she petitions a court to grant her custody or guardianship.

    But.... That "notorized paper for Temporary custody" and the subsequent child support order could involve some form of court-ordered custody or guardianship. The documents and court records should be reviewed by a lawyer to determine exactly what happened.
